REEL 48 COMMENTARY
Except for the conversation in take 1, similar material here as on reel 47.
1. Starts in screen room.
pulp wash area.
kay-meer digester area.
5'30" explosive sound of valve release.
*5'45" conversation with men in the office recovery area.
*lime kiln.
*going out of enclosed control room by paper rollers, into din of machinery.
pulp storage area, deep hum.
*pulp machines, added notes to same hum.
2. Starts in machine room (insulated), then pulp machine area which has a great musical hum. Stock being pumped into headbox of pulp machine.
dryers.
*pulp cutter (regular chopping sound).
*bales of pulp being tied, short musical "snap".
*forklift trucks in storage area.
12'30" peace and quiet at last, lots of conversation, secretary's wind chimes.
